Hi, I've purchased an edible log from pet smart for my trio, and they are loving it Smile ... but recently I heard that they aren't safe? I'm just wondering what the deal is because it's the only thing that they've really chewed on.

The first ingredient, if the item I'm thinking of is correct, is pine shavings, but since there's also honey animals are almost guaranteed to ingest a significant amount of it. I avoided them as I believed this could lead to impaction.

If they're pooping normally, no need to be concerned. I've not heard of a specific case where a mouse has become ill from these, but if it could hurt your mice in theory, it's not worth the risk. It annoys me that pet shops sell these things as perfectly safe and edible when they're not. Mice can chew wood, but they're not supposed to eat large amounts of it, which could easily happen if you smoother it in honey Worry as pet owners we often blindly trust the pet stores and assume that they wouldn't sell something dangerous to our pets.
